Growth disorders in Greece: baseline data from a multicentre observational study (GENESIS)

Aloumanis Kyriakos , Karachaliou Feneli , Vlachopapadopoulou Elpis , Michalacos Stephanos , Papathanasiou Asteroula , Chrysis Dionysis , Stamoyannou Lela , Karis Christos , Spiliotis Bessie , Drossinos Vangelis , Chrousos George

Aim: The Genetics and Neuroendocrinology of Short Stature International Study (GeNeSIS) is an open-label multinational observational study which collects information on management, clinical outcomes and treatment safety of children with growth disorders.
